Heavy Duty Construction Overview
The foundation of any Heavy Duty Metal Sheet Rack Warehouse system lies in its frame design. This rack uses high-strength carbon steel with a minimum yield strength of 350 MPa. Upright frames are roll-formed from 2.5mm thick steel into a closed C-section profile that resists bending in both front-to-back and side-to-side directions. Cross braces between uprights use X-pattern bracing made from 2.0mm steel angles, creating a rigid structure that prevents racking (parallelogram distortion) under uneven loads. The base plate incorporates four adjustable leveling feet that compensate for floor irregularities up to 25mm. Each foot has a 100mm diameter pad to distribute point loads and prevent concrete spalling.

Exceptional Load Capacity
Standard industrial shelving typically supports 500-1000 kg per shelf. This Adjustable Heavy Duty Rack achieves 5000 kg (5 tons or 11,000 lbs) per layer – five to ten times greater capacity. Achieving this rating required engineering improvements beyond simply using thicker steel. The shelf beams incorporate a box section design with internal stiffeners. Beam-to-upright connections use a three-point locking mechanism: a top hook, bottom hook, and side safety pin. This connection distributes the vertical load across 150mm of upright surface area, preventing the localized crushing failure common with cheaper racks. Load testing confirms less than 1mm of beam deflection at full 5-ton capacity, which means stored items remain level and stable.

Adjustable Shelf Design
The defining feature of this product line is its fully adjustable shelving system. Shelf beams attach to the uprights at 50mm vertical increments, providing fine-tuning ability for different product heights. A warehouse storing engine blocks one month and exhaust systems the next can reconfigure shelf positions without tools – simply lift the safety pin, slide the beam upward, and reinsert the pin. Each beam includes a visual position indicator that confirms proper engagement with the upright’s keyhole slots. For high-turnover areas, operators can set shelf spacing just 10mm taller than the tallest stored item, maximizing the number of shelves within a given building height.

Anti-Rust Powder Coating
Industrial warehouses expose racks to moisture from condensation, washdown procedures, and leaking roofs. The Anti-Rust Powder Coating applied to all steel components provides a durable barrier. The coating process follows automotive-grade standards: pretreatment includes iron phosphate wash, reverse osmosis rinse, and a non-chrome sealer. The powder material uses a TGIC-free polyester formulation that resists yellowing under UV light – important for racks located near loading dock doors. Curing occurs at 200°C for 20 minutes, creating a cross-linked surface that withstands impact from forklifts and pallet jacks. Coating thickness averages 80 microns on exposed surfaces and 50 microns on hidden interior surfaces. This treatment allows the rack to operate for 10+ years in unheated warehouses without rust perforation.

Modular Expandable Design
Warehouse storage needs rarely remain constant. Adding new product lines or seasonal inventory spikes often requires additional capacity. The Modular Expandable Design of this rack system addresses this reality. Individual rack bays connect side-by-side using shared upright columns. A typical configuration starts with three bays – each bay measuring 2700mm wide, 1200mm deep, and 4000mm tall. When additional capacity becomes necessary, operators add a fourth bay by bolting new uprights to the existing frame and installing additional beams. No demolition or relocation of existing stored goods required. For facilities with changing ceiling heights, the upright sections come in 1000mm, 1500mm, and 2000mm modules that stack together. Starting with a 3000mm tall rack, adding a 1000mm extension module increases capacity by 33% without replacing the base.

Integrated Safety Features
High-capacity racks introduce safety risks if not properly designed. This product incorporates multiple safety systems. Each shelf beam includes a retention lip that prevents pallets from sliding off the front during forklift placement. Rear crossbars spaced at 600mm intervals stop items from falling out the back. Upright frame footplates have pre-drilled anchor holes – floor anchors are included with every rack and required for installations above 2500mm height or with seismic activity risk. Additionally, the rack system accepts optional safety accessories: column protectors (heavy-gauge steel sleeves that wrap around the lower 500mm of uprights), wire decking (replaces solid shelves for sprinkler water penetration), and end-of-aisle netting (prevents items from rolling off the ends).

Installation and Quality Assurance
The manufacturer provides on-site installation and debugging services through a team of over 40 technical engineers. The installation process begins with a site survey to verify floor flatness, overhead clearance, and seismic zone classification. Anchor bolt locations are marked using a laser layout tool. After drilling and setting anchors, each upright gets leveled independently before torquing the bolts to 150 Nm. Beam installation follows a specific sequence that pre-stresses the frame for stability. Final steps include load testing of randomly selected shelves using calibrated hydraulic jacks and deflection gauges. The quality control department, certified to ISO9001, audits each installation and provides a signed completion certificate.
